What is the recommended dose of inhaled NO?
 
  a. 10 ppm
  b. 20 ppm
  c. 30 ppm
  d. 40 ppm

Answer to Question 2

ANS: B
The recommended inhaled NO dose is 20 ppm with an optimal response achieved when lung in-flation is maximized.

Medications that are definitely not safe to take when breastfeeding include radioactive drugs, antimetabolites, some cancer (chemotherapy) agents, bromocriptine, ergotamine, methotrexate, and cyclosporine.

Although the Roman numeral for the number 4 has always been taught to have been "IV," according to historians, the ancient Romans probably used "IIII" most of the time. This is partially backed up by the fact that early grandfather clocks displayed IIII for the number 4 instead of IV. Early clockmakers apparently thought that the IIII balanced out the VIII (used for the number 8) on the clock face and that it just looked better.
